Define Quartzite

Quartzite is one of the important type of rocks. If we have to define Quartzite in general, Quartzite is a non-foliated metamorphic rock that forms by the metamorphism of pure quartz Sandstone. Quartzite comes under Metamorphic Rocks. All Metamorphic Rocks have similar properties and formation process.
